Yair,
Are you calling PropertiesConfigurator, DOMConfigrator, JoranConfigrator yourself? If you are, you can fill in the value of the variable before invoking the configurator.
To give you an idea, assume you use PropertiesConfigurator.
Properties props = new Properties(); FileInputStream istream = new FileInputStream("/your/config/file.properties"); props.load(istream); istream.close()
// set the value of "now" to a string formatted according to your
// liking
SimpleDateFormat sdf = new SimpleDateFormat("yyyy-MM-dd-HH-ss");
props.setProperty("now", sdf.format(new Date()); // now configure log4j
new PropertiesConfigurator().doConfigure(props,
LogManager.getLogggingRepository());
Your config file in properties format would look like
log4j.rootLogger=debug, KUKU
log4j.appender.KUKU=org.apache.log4j.FileAppender
log4j.appender.KUKU.File=/wombat/kuku-${now}.log
etc...I'd like to note that the choice of using "kuku" as a file name was yours, certainly not mine. :-)
